What companies run services between Linz, Austria and Praha 10, Czechia?
FlixBus operates a bus from Linz Industriezeile to Prague 5 times a week. Tickets cost Kč 400–700 and the journey takes 3h 45m. Alternatively, ÖBB EuroCity operates a train from Linz Hbf to Praha Hlavni Nadrazi 4 times a day. Tickets cost Kč 1,500–2,600 and the journey takes 3h 45m. Railjet also services this route once daily.
